Title: Re: HS # 4 west of Okeechobee Post by: duroc825 on November 06, 2008, 09:44:04 PM You can get # at the race, it might not be the # ya want but you can get one. Transponders are there at signup for $20 I think. Only thing about getting # at the race is that you'll need to bring a pack of #'s with ya cause ya won't know it till you're there. I think your plates will need to be red with white numbers and you'll need the letter C too. Here is link for more info.
